PIU Activity Reports Discussed

Chaired by Prime Minister Hovik Abrahamyan, the Government discussed PIU activity reports for the first six months of 2015. The PIU directors presented their performance and the planned projects and problems. Noting that the amount of work had doubled as compared to the same period last year, Prime Minister Abrahamyan urged the PIU supervisors to ensure that the ongoing projects are completed in a timely manner and in accordance with the established standards. PM Holds Farewell Meeting with Netherlands Ambassador

Prime Minister Hovik Abrahamyan received Ambassador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ary of the Kingdom of the Netherlands Hans Horbach (residence in Tbilisi), who is completing his diplomatic mission in our country. The Premier thanked the Ambassador for tenure-long efforts toward strengthening and expanding Armenia-Netherlands relations. IT Development Agenda Discussed

Prime Minister Hovik Abrahamyan received a delegation from the Armenian Union of Information Technology Enterprises. The meeting focused on the development of IT industry and promotion of innovative ideas. In particular, reference was made to the technological modernization of the educational system, high-quality personnel training, international cooperation and investment.
